NIH E FAR Co abo at n 2013 mcb 1/10/13 HPTN 071: PopART NIAID Hayes LSHTM PopART South Africa/ Zambia $10,000,000 PEPFAR PEPFAR, NIAID, NIMH, BMGF Randomized study of combination prevention interventions involving 21 communities in Zambia and South Africa. The intervention, taking place in PEPFAR-funded clinics in the intervention communities, is scheduled to begin by September 30. Enrollment in the population cohort (which will be used to measure the HIV incidence outcome)will begin next month. Project SEARCH NIAID Havlir CTU suppl UCSF SEARCH Uganda/Kenya $2,000,000 PEPFAR PEPFAR, WB, NIAID POC CD4 testing with streamlined initiation of care in Uganda.
